= 使用我在虚拟专用服务器上为我自己的自托管服务器创建的 VPN =

![ ](httpswww.redditstatic.com/desktop2x/img/renderTimingPixel.png)

嗨朋友们

我家有服务器。该服务器运行各种东西。我想用它制作一个公共 minecraft 服务器,但不想将我的 IP 暴露给 13 岁孩子的世界,他们为了史诗般的搞笑而进行 dox 和 ddos​​。

因此,我想使用自己制作的 VPN (openvpn)。但是,我不知道从哪里开始或开始。我什至可以在使用 VPN 的服务器上托管吗?如果是这样,我可以使用该 VPN 仅在单个端口上工作吗?我不太了解 VPN 或它们的工作原理,如果我让这难以理解,我深表歉意。

![ ](httpswww.redditstatic.com/desktop2x/img/renderTimingPixel.png)

VPN是一种用来连接电脑的软件,本身并不是一个系统。

您可能需要的是 VPS。 VPS 是一个在线虚拟系统,远离您的家庭网络,年轻的先生可以在其中托管先生的 Minecraft 服务器,远离 13 岁孩子的窥探之手。

热门站点包括:Scaleway、Digital Ocean、Linode 等。

如果您想通过 VPN 访问进一步保护您的服务器,以便您和您的好友是唯一可以连接的人,您可以在您的服务器旁边安装一个 VPN 服务器,例如 wireguard,并让您的朋友使用客户端文件进行连接,就像您一样,以防止痞子。

或者年轻的先生可以在家里的所述服务器上安装 wireguard VPN,除了 Wireguard 端口之外什么都不发布到互联网,然后以这种方式进行操作。

所以我在我的 VPS(虚拟专用服务器)和我的家庭服务器上为我的电子邮件做了类似的事情。

我为此使用了 wireguard,因为它更直接,因为它只是作为网络接口呈现。你想要做的是一个 iptables 端口转发

一般 wireguard iptables 操作方法:httpswww.cyberciti.biz/faq/how-to-set-up-wireguard-firewall-rules-in-linux/

Wireguard iptables 端口转发:httpslewiswalsh.com/port-forwarding-with-iptables-for-wireguard/

*编辑:就像你说的那样,你有一个 VPS 已经跳过了复杂性,只是在 VPS 本身上运行服务器? Minecraft 服务器并没有那么大的资源消耗(如果没记错的话)

== 关于社区 ==

成员

在线